FHL Hans Ölvebro: You were starting to talk about the American connection.
Eugene de Kock: Philip Powell made it very clear that there was a very strong American connection between the International Freedom Foundation as well as with a Longreach company a definite, or implied, or definite implied CIA connection. There is no doubt about it.
Philip Powell enjoyed a lot of a trust in this company where they operated in. I give you another example later.
He had to fly to Pakistan and pick up two or three of the chief mujadeens, or these leaders. And had to fly them into Huambo, which was their Unita head quarters in Angola.
And at the same time, and I believe it was a riganeer (?), (brigader) at the same time they flew in the Contras and all the other South American, rightwing groups Sandinistas to whatever happened there.
There was so many little wars going on there. There was definitely a very very strong American connection concerning that.

FHL Hans Ölvebro: Can you tell us exactly what exactly told you about the murder of Mr Olof Palme.
Eugene de Kock: What he said is that this man is the man who shot Olof Palme, and that is it.
He never gave details how the man walked up or if he did walk up or if he was on a bike or if he was in a car or whatever.
